Smooth yarns give nice definition to textured patterns. A graphic example: the petrol blue turtleneck in classic Aran stitches.

Size: Man's Medium

Materials:

Lana Grossa "Alta Moda Superbaby Fine" (63% Merino Wool, 27% Baby Alpaca, 10% Polyamide, yardage = 105 m/25 g) 700 g petrol (#10). 

Knitting needles one pair each sizes US 4 and 6 (3.5 and 4mm), one circular needle size US 4 (3.5mm).

Rib Pat: K2, P2 Rib.

Stockinette st: Knit on RS rows, purl on WS rows.

Rev St st: Purl on RS rows, knit on WS rows.

Cable Pat A: Follow Chart A.

Cable Pat B: Follow Chart B.

Slip st rib over 4 sts:

RS rows: sl 1 st purlwise with yarn at back, p2, sl 1 st purlwise with yarn at back.

WS rows: p the sl st, k2, p the sl st

Double Seed St: Row 1: K1, *p1, k1; rep from *. Rows 2 and 4: K the knit sts and p the purl sts. Row 3:_P1, *k1, p1; rep from *. Rep rows 1-4. 

Gauge:

Over all pats on Front and Back: 30-31 sts and 34 rows = approx 4 x 4"/10 x 10 cm.

Cable Pat A: 34-35 sts and 34 rows = approx 4 x 4"/10 x 10 cm.

Back: With US 4 (3.5mm) needles cast on 152 sts and work in Rib Pat for 2 3/4"/7 cm, and on the last row inc 20 sts evenly across = 172 sts. Change to US 6 (4mm) needles and work in pats as foll: k1 (selvage st), 16 sts Cable Pat A = 16 sts between the arrows, 1 st Rev St st, 4 sts Slip st rib, 16 sts Cable B, 13 sts Seed st, 2 sts Rev St st, 4 sts Slip st rib, 26 sts Cable Pat A, 6 sts in St st, 26 sts Cable Pat A, 4 sts Slip st rib, 2 sts Rev St st, 13 sts Seed st, 16 sts Cable Pat B, 4 sts Slip st rib,17 sts Cable Pat A (= the first 17 sts of the chart), k1 (selvage st).

Work even until piece measures 17 3/4"/45 cm from beg. For the armhole shaping bind off 17 sts at beg of next 2 rows = 138 sts. Work even until armhole measures 9"/23 cm. For the shoulder shaping bind off 6 sts at beg of next 2 rows, then 8 sts at beg of next 8 rows. Bind off row rem 62 sts.

Front: Work same as Back until piece measures 25"/63 cm from beg. For the neck shaping bind off the center 22 sts and working both sides at once, bind off from each neck edge 5 sts once, 4 sts once, 3 sts once, 2 sts once and dec 1 st every 2nd row 6 times.

Sleeves: With US 4 (3.5mm) needles cast on 66 sts and work in Rib Pat for 2 3/4"/7 cm, and on the last WS row inc 24 sts evenly across = 90 sts. Change to US 6 (4mm) needles and cont in Cable Pat A as foll: k1 (selvage st), work the rep 5 times, work the 8 sts after the 2nd arrow, k1 (selvage st). For the sleeve shaping, inc 1 st each side on the 7th row, then every 6th row 4 times and every 4th row 30 times, working inc sts into pat = 160 sts. When piece measures 22 1/2"/57.5 cm from beg, bind off. 

Finishing: Sew shoulder seams. For the turtleneck, with RS facing and circular needle, pick up and k approx 124 sts evenly around neck edge and work in Rib Pat for approx 10 1/4"/26 cm, then bind off sts loosely. Set in sleeves. Sew side and sleeve seams.
